Transaction 7256117721b9829fb072498e565220bcd1d145e33dda8e90998a33878f0c8a5e

1 Input
2 Outputs
  • 7256117721b9829fb072498e565220bcd1d145e33dda8e90998a33878f0c8a5e:0
  • value  5223602
    address  3KwEWJrUyET729kXegsPkV98B3orhVofAU
  • 7256117721b9829fb072498e565220bcd1d145e33dda8e90998a33878f0c8a5e:1
  • value  310047340
    address  3KURdrQyus7VCGABdtgBy9Rk6kBbC5rDcW